What is a Mystery Shopper?
The concept of a mystery shopper refers to a survey where you hire someone to evaluate the customer service experience in a business. This practice aims to collect information about service quality, environment, and products offered, providing a realistic view of the business’s operations. Check out our content about nexloo.

The mystery shopper acts as an ordinary consumer, performing interactions that help assess the service impartially. Best Practices for Implementing a Mystery Shopper Program
When implementing a mystery shopper program, define clear objectives. Determine which aspects of service need to be evaluated. For Trendy Shoe Store, defining objectives resulted in a 25% gain in positive evaluations after implementing actions based on observations.

Common Mistakes When Working with Mystery Shoppers and How to Avoid Them
Avoid a lack of clarity in objectives and the inappropriate selection of evaluators. HD Pharmacy Chain learned this lesson when the lack of representative feedback did not result in improvements. Select mystery shoppers who genuinely resemble your target audience.
